Located atop the hill of the ancient Certosa abbey of Florence, only 4 miles away from the ancient walls of downtown Florence, the Rustico della Certosa house is the ideal lodging for those who wish to visit the city during the day, and relax by night. Immersed in the green countryside of Florence, the Rustico della Certosa house is located by the Certosa highway exit, 5 minutes away, in a strategic position to visit the wonderful hills of Tuscany!
During the day, it is possible to visit the countless works of art of Florence, but also to organize short day-trips in the luxuriant Chianti countryside, with the Rustico being in the Chianti Putto region. You can enjoy Greve in Chianti, also known as the pearl of Chianti, only 30 minutes away, the beautiful San Gimignano about 35 minutes away, the famous town of Siena about 40 minutes away Sant'Andera in Percussina with the Niccolo' Machiavelli museum-house only 5 minutes away (all distances are calculated based on car transportation).
It's very easy to reach the historic city centre of Florence from our property: infact the nearest bus stop is 2Kms away for the property. In front of the bus stop there is a big FREE parking, where you can park the car and catch the bus for the historic city centre. The bus takes 10-15 minutes to reach the Duomo of Florence.
For the past few centuries, the Rustico della Certosa was a simple building, created to welcome peasants working on the surrounding hills. During the 2000's, the building was completely renovated, paying close attention not to remove or alter those unique elements that remind it's rustic past, that is, the big fireplace in the middle of the dining room, the ancient exposed wood beams, and the original cotto floors from Impruneta.
The 5 bedrooms are tastefully furnished, inspired by the major historic events of the surrounding areas. There are a fully equipped kitchen, a big dining room and a big living room. In the dining room there is also a cupboard furnished by all necessary to testing the Italian wine (Professional testing glasses, decanter, information about the most famous Tuscany wine cellars).
The garden, in the spring and summer months, is a true oasis, where you can relax, maybe read a book and enjoy a cocktail. If the sun is hitting really hard, you can seek refuge under the big umbrella and nap on the lawn chairs available for you.

This place is well-kept by its very friendly owners, situated about 7 km south of Florence center. The garden is pretty and large. The rooms are nice and large also, a few need fly nets on the windows however. Eventhough they do not mention on their web page, they have wireless internet access which needs a little bit more power. If you will order a menu of mamma (Mina) don't miss Francesina. Ideal vacation house for a group of 6-10. La Certosa restaurant nearby is quite good, not expensive and although seems to be serving large groups, it keeps the qualty above average. The best ice cream was in the village of Stia, about 50 km east.
